Camden County, Georgia Sales Tax Rate 2023 Up to 7%

The Camden County Sales Tax is 3%

A county-wide sales tax rate of 3% is applicable to localities in Camden County, in addition to the 4% Georgia sales tax.

None of the cities or local governments within Camden County collect additional local sales taxes.

Here's how Camden County's maximum sales tax rate of 7% compares to other counties around the United States:

  •   Lower maximum sales tax than 87% of Georgia counties
  •   Lower maximum sales tax than 55% of counties nationwide

Tax Rates By City in Camden County, Georgia

The total sales tax rate in any given location can be broken down into state, county, city, and special district rates. Georgia has a 4% sales tax and Camden County collects an additional 3%, so the minimum sales tax rate in Camden County is 7% (not including any city or special district taxes). This table shows the total sales tax rates for all cities and towns in Camden County, including all local taxes.

City Sales Tax Rate Tax Jurisdiction
Kingsland 7% Kingsland
Saint Marys 7% Saint Marys
Woodbine 7% Woodbine
Waverly 7% Camden
White Oak 7% Camden
Kings Bay 7% Saint Marys

Camden County, Georgia has a maximum sales tax rate of 7% and an approximate population of 38,795.

Sales tax rates in Camden County are determined by four different tax jurisdictions, Camden, Kingsland, Saint Marys and Woodbine.
